    Following our visit to the Po Lin Monastery 2 years ago when we couldn't see 10 feet ahead because of the mist we always wanted to return. As today had the best weather forecast we set off on the metro to Tung Chung on Lantau Island where we caught the bus up to the Monastery as the gondolas were shut for maintenance (as they were last time we visited). The monastery lies 1700 feet above sea level and the bronze Buddha is a very impressive 112 feet high - one of the largest seated Buddha images in the world. The main temple is impressive too not only with the gold Buddhas statues but with all the decoration inside and outside. From here we walked back down the 4 miles to Tung Chung. It was a steep path all the way down on the edge of a woods with good views out towards the airport. An added bonus were the caches we collected on the way down.
